Output 5eb85c6bf8dc5eba8f10f128c48722c5903fff7790dbf33ed5df3e72f98f55b1:0

value
508901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612c6c1d5bc4c88677d66abdcc30dd594e72e14e OP_EQUAL
address
3AYpgfioTeNLZ6oa4Pn5XG1TUFnXZwtTEC
transaction
5eb85c6bf8dc5eba8f10f128c48722c5903fff7790dbf33ed5df3e72f98f55b1
confirmations
267202
spent
true